The Hallowick Audio Guide API exposes a /tours endpoint that returns available exhibit narrations for a given gallery code, including duration, language variants, and download size. Support staff diagnosing playback complaints should first fetch the tour manifest and compare the reported asset version against the visitor's app logs. All manifest requests against the diagnostics environment must be authenticated, so include the bearer token shown below.

session JWT of yawep-yawep = eyJhbGciOiJIUzI1NiIsInR5cCI6IkpXVCJ9.eyJzdWIiOiI3pWF3_In0.aXYsHiog

## v4.2.0 — Audit-Log Viewer

Good news for support: the Ledgerlens viewer now lets you filter audit entries by actor, action, and date range in one query instead of three. Export to CSV finally respects the active filters, and the dreaded spinner-of-doom on large workspaces is fixed. Known quirk: timestamps still show in workspace-local time. Bug reports and feature gripes for this release go to the person named below.

named custodian: Belius Casath Ulaix Sorius

Welcome to on-call for the Glimmerpane design system! Our snapshot tests live in the `snapcheck` suite and run on every merge to main. If a UI component changes visually, the diff bot flags it — usually it's an intentional tweak, so just approve the new baseline. If it's 2am and snapshots are failing across the board, it's almost always a font-loading race, not your problem. To unlock the baseline store and re-approve snapshots in bulk, use the recovery passphrase below.

recovery phrase for tahag-taguf: wenix-caswyn

## Inventory reconciliation job (recon-nightly)

Quick heads-up before your first release: recon-nightly compares warehouse counts in Stockhollow against the order ledger and flags drift over 0.5%. It kicks off at 02:00 and usually wraps by 03:30 — don't ship anything that touches the ledger schema during that window, or you'll get a very grumpy mismatch report. Rerunning is safe; it's idempotent. If a run hangs or the drift report looks wild, ping the fulfillment data team at the address below.

alerts address for bajop-yahog: istwyn@lumiclabs.internal